TD-W8961N 300Mbps Wireless N ADSL2+ Modem Router User Guide Chapter 2 Hardware Installation 2.1 The Front Panel Figure 2-1 The LEDs locate on the front panel. They indicate the device's working status. For details, please refer to LED Explanation. LED Explanation: Name (Power) (ADSL) (INTERNET) (WLAN) (WPS) Status On Off On Flash Off On Flash Off On Flash Off On Flash Off Indication The modem router is powered on. The modem router is off. Please ensure that the power adapter is connected correctly. ADSL line is synchronized and ready to use. The ADSL negotiation is in progress. ADSL synchronization fails. Please refer to Note 1 for troubleshooting. The network is available with a successful Internet connection. There is data being transmitted or received via the Internet. There is no successful Internet connection or the modem router is operating in Bridge mode. Please refer to Note 2 for troubleshooting. Wireless is enabled but no data is being transmitted. The modem router is sending or receiving data over the wireless network. Wireless function is disabled. A wireless device has been successfully added to the network by WPS function. WPS handshaking is in process and will continue for about 2 minutes. Please press the WPS button on other wireless devices that you want to add to the network while the LED is flashing.
